On April 13, the Sharon Board of Selectmen approved the revamping of the “Old Corral” section of Deborah Sampson Park to make it into an official dog park. The “Old Corral” section is located between Cedar and Gunhouse Streets; this area will be a great addition to the “Sharon Greenway” that connects Deborah Sampson Park with the Massapoag Trail.
The new dog park will become one of over 600 official dog parks nationwide.
The Commonwealth has several, including parks in Boston, Framingham, Cambridge and Jamaica Plain. Before the Dog Park, Sharon dogs had no place to run freely, as many of the area recreation parks banned dogs, while others restricted dogs to being on a leash at all times. Happily, that is no longer the case and we are excited that the dog park will benefit not only dog owners, but the entire community by preserving a beautiful, secluded forest area for a low impact use.
